How To Fix LTR2_UI_CM009 - Error while copying the content module


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: LTR2_UI_CM - Message Class for Content Module Editor

  • Message number: 009

  • Message text: Error while copying the content module

    The SAP error message LTR2_UI_CM009 typically occurs in the context of SAP Learning Solution (LSO) or SAP Learning Hub when there is an issue with copying a content module. This error can arise due to various reasons, including configuration issues, missing data, or system inconsistencies.

    Cause:

    1. Missing or Incomplete Data: The content module you are trying to copy may have missing or incomplete data, such as prerequisites or dependencies that are not met.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to perform the copy operation.
    3. System Configuration: There may be configuration issues in the Learning Solution settings that prevent the copying of content modules.
    4. Technical Issues: There could be underlying technical issues, such as database inconsistencies or system errors.

    Solution:

    1. Check Data Completeness: Ensure that the content module you are trying to copy is complete and does not have any missing prerequisites or dependencies.
    2. Review Authorizations: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to copy content modules. This can be done by checking the user roles and permissions in the SAP system.
    3. System Configuration: Review the configuration settings in the Learning Solution to ensure that everything is set up correctly. This may involve checking the content management settings and ensuring that all necessary components are activated.
    4. Error Logs: Check the system logs for any additional error messages or details that can provide more context about the issue. This can help in diagnosing the problem more accurately.
    5.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or support notes related to the error message for any specific guidance or known issues.
    6.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ists after trying the above solutions,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ance. They can provide more detailed troubleshooting steps based on the specific system configuration and error context.
